An overly convoluted "Taken" knockoff that weirdly also functions as a loose remake of "Rambo: Last Blood" (Sylvester Stallone co-wrote this), "A Working Man" is 35 minutes too long and wins no prizes for originality, tact, or finesse.
However, as a significantly less racist version of both those movies mentioned above and powered by the 'so uncharismatic that he loops all the way around to charismatic' dipshit charm of Jason Statham playing literally the only role he ever plays, I very much enjoyed kicking back and laughing along to the sound of shrapnel as my brain slowly devoured itself.
